Webcasting is the broadcasting of an event over the Internet.
Software Streaming
VideoLAN is a free open-source solution which allows you to broadcast media from your computer, live or already recorded. Many formats and codecs are supported (except for Real).
Live
To broadcast live, you'll need a Windows or Linux server connected online with a video capture device. You should negotiate with the manager or owner of the venue if it is possible to connect the computer such that the wedding could be filmed and streamed on location.
With Linux (through a capture card) or Windows (through a USB DirectShow device), you can feed a live stream straight from a camera connected to your computer.
Recorded
You can also use VideoLAN to broadcast a video you already recorded.
Intellectual Property Issues
If you are broadcasting a recording of your wedding, make sure that you have appropriate rights to do so.
If any music or video materials are being broadcast during a recording of your wedding, make sure that you have appropriate rights to broadcast them.
